Nick Coghlan
9c1aed8f94 Close #7475: Restore binary & text transform codecs
The codecs themselves were restored in Python 3.2, this
completes the restoration by adding back the convenience
aliases.

These aliases were originally left out due to confusing
errors when attempting to use them with the text encoding
specific convenience methods. Python 3.4 includes several
improvements to those errors, thus permitting the aliases
to be restored as well.

Serhiy Storchaka
58cf607d13 Issue #12892: The utf-16* and utf-32* codecs now reject (lone) surrogates.
The utf-16* and utf-32* encoders no longer allow surrogate code points
(U+D800-U+DFFF) to be encoded.
The utf-32* decoders no longer decode byte sequences that correspond to
surrogate code points.
The surrogatepass error handler now works with the utf-16* and utf-32* codecs.

Based on patches by Victor Stinner and Kang-Hao (Kenny) Lu.
